Open for about one year, Big Tony’s Original Wood Fired
Pizza Company, 911 Walker Road, brings new life to a place dating
back to the late 1800s.

So many
fine buildings in Olde Walkerville have stood the test of time.
While much of Windsor’s heritage architecture has been torn
down, the model town that Hiram Walker built remains a shining
example of historic preservation.
